Thus, Eumaios 's feasts for Odysseus in Odyssey 14.72-114 and 14.414-456 are, to all intents and purposes, secular feasts, yet most of the elements contained are also standard elements of more overtly god-centered sacrificial feasts, such as that to Athena in Odyssey 3 or that to Apollo in Iliad 1.
